Modification of electromagnetic structure functions for the γ Z-box diagram

Abstract

The γ Z-box diagram for parity violating elastic e-p scattering has recently undergone a thorough analysis by several research groups. Though all now agree on the analytic form of the diagram, the numerical results differ due to the treatment of the structure functions, F1,2,3γ Z(x,Q2). Currently, F1,2,3γ Z(x,Q2) at low Q2 and W2 must be approximated through the modification of existing fits to electromagnetic structure function data. We motivate and describe the modification used to obtain F1,2γ Z(x,Q2) in our previous work. We also describe an alternative modification and compare the result to our original calculation. Finally, we present a new modification procedure to acquire F3γ Z(x,Q2) in the resonance region and calculate the axial contribution to the γ Z-box diagram. Details of these modifications will illuminate where discrepancies between the groups arise and where future improvements can be made.
